About Arthur

Arthur Brendze is a licensed marriage and family therapist with 30 years of experience in California. He helps people who are stressed, anxious, grieving, or struggling with anger and relationship issues. He works with clients facing career change, parenting strain, addiction concerns, or questions about intimacy and self-esteem.

He approaches each person with respect, sensitivity, and compassion. Sessions are adapted to what the client needs, with straightforward conversation and practical steps.

Background and approach

Arthur aims to make the therapy process easy to follow and geared to real-life changes. Over three decades he has supported people through major life transitions, trauma and abuse, and loss. He also addresses issues connected to adoption and foster care, attachment and abandonment, and aging or caregiver stress.

His work includes helping with sleep problems, emptiness, and co-morbid mental health concerns. Arthur uses evidence-based therapeutic techniques tailored to each client rather than a one-size-fits-all plan. He focuses on building stronger communication, healthier coping skills, and clearer decision-making.

The goal is to leave sessions with concrete next steps and small practices to try between meetings. People seeking help with LGBT questions, relationship repair, or anger management often begin by describing what feels most urgent. Arthur listens first, then designs a path forward that fits daily life and personal goals.

Approaches and Online Therapy Options

Arthur uses evidence-based therapeutic techniques that focus on clear goals and practical skills. One common approach is problem-focused therapy that zeroes in on specific behaviors and coping strategies to manage anger, stress, or sleep problems. This method breaks larger issues into manageable steps and helps clients try small changes between sessions.

Another frequently used approach emphasizes communication and attachment work to improve relationships and intimacy. This involves noticing interaction patterns, practicing new ways of speaking and listening, and building healthier boundaries for more stable connections.

Finding the best approach is a cooperative process. Arthur will talk with each person about goals, past efforts, and what feels most helpful. Together they decide which techniques to try and adjust the plan as progress is made.

Online therapy offers several practical benefits for this work. Video calls allow face-to-face conversation for role-play and reading nonverbal cues. Phone sessions can be easier when bandwidth is low or for brief check-ins. Live chat and text messaging make it possible to get timely support between sessions or to work when being on camera is difficult. These options provide flexibility to fit therapy into a busy life.
